The UFC's highly anticipated Freedom 250 event has been at the center of controversy since its announcement, with several parties questioning the promotion's ties to the White House. As the fight inches closer to reality, a lawsuit seeking to block the event has taken a dramatic turn.

The government has officially responded to the lawsuit, arguing that critics waited far too long to challenge the event. According to reports, the Trump administration claims that plaintiffs should have acted sooner to address their concerns. This development comes just days before the first bout is scheduled to take place.

The UFC Freedom 250 event was initially met with skepticism due to its association with President Donald Trump's administration. Critics argue that the promotion has become increasingly politicized, leading to allegations of favoritism and censorship. The lawsuit at the center of this controversy alleges that the UFC has unfairly leveraged its ties to the White House for financial gain.

While details surrounding the lawsuit are still emerging, it appears that the government is pushing back against claims made by plaintiffs. This development could have significant implications for the future of mixed martial arts promotions in the United States.
